How Does Seasonal Weather Affect International Flights?
Seasonal weather plays a significant role in flight operations. For instance, summer months often bring thunderstorms, hurricanes, and heatwaves, while winter can introduce snowstorms and icy conditions. These weather events can lead to:
-
Flight Delays and Cancellations: Adverse weather conditions can disrupt flight schedules, leading to delays or cancellations.
-
Airport Congestion: Inclement weather can cause congestion at airports, affecting both departures and arrivals.
-
Operational Challenges: Pilots and ground crews may face challenges due to reduced visibility, runway conditions, and other weather-related factors.
How Can Travelers Stay Informed About Flight Delays?
Staying informed about potential flight disruptions is crucial. Here are some tools and strategies to consider:
-
Weather Forecasts: Regularly check weather forecasts for both departure and arrival locations. This helps anticipate potential disruptions.
-
Flight Tracking Apps: Utilize apps that provide real-time flight status updates, including delays and cancellations. These apps often offer push notifications to keep you informed.
-
Airport Delay Maps: Some platforms offer interactive maps showing live airport delay statuses, helping you monitor potential disruptions at your departure or arrival airports.
